What is Komatsu PC800-7 Fault Code H-14?
Fault Code H-14 on the Komatsu PC800-7 indicates a hydraulic oil temperature sensor circuit malfunction or abnormal temperature reading in the hydraulic system. This code is triggered when the Electronic Control Module (ECM) detects voltage signals outside the normal operating range from the hydraulic oil temperature sensor, or when actual oil temperatures exceed safe operational limits.
The hydraulic oil temperature sensor is critical for the PC800-7's performance management system. It monitors thermal conditions within the hydraulic circuit to prevent component damage, maintain optimal viscosity, and protect seals, pumps, and motors from heat-related failures. When this sensor malfunctions, the machine may enter protective modes that significantly limit productivity.
Common Symptoms
When Code H-14 is active, operators typically experience:
- Warning light illumination on the monitor panel, often accompanied by an audible alarm
- Reduced hydraulic performance including slower cycle times and decreased digging force
- Automatic machine derate or speed limitation to protect hydraulic components
- Erratic temperature gauge readings or display showing abnormally high/low temperatures
- In severe cases, automatic shutdown if the system cannot verify safe operating temperatures
Potential Causes
The most common technical causes for H-14 on used PC800-7 excavators include:
- Faulty hydraulic oil temperature sensor due to age-related degradation or internal element failure
- Damaged wiring harness or corroded connectors, particularly at rub points near the hydraulic tank or along the chassis frame
- Broken or shorted sensor wiring caused by vibration, abrasion against metal edges, or rodent damage
- Contaminated hydraulic oil causing actual overheating conditions that trigger legitimate warnings
- ECM communication errors or poor ground connections affecting signal integrity
- Connector pin corrosion from moisture intrusion, especially common in machines operating in wet environments
How to Troubleshoot and Fix Code H-14
Step 1: Visual Inspection Begin by inspecting the hydraulic oil temperature sensor location (typically mounted on or near the hydraulic tank). Check for physical damage, oil leaks, and examine the wiring harness for obvious wear, cuts, or chafing. On used excavators, pay special attention to areas where harnesses contact frame members or pass through bulkheads.
Step 2: Electrical Testing Using a digital multimeter, disconnect the sensor connector and measure resistance across the sensor terminals. Compare readings against Komatsu specifications (typically 200-400 ohms at 20°C, varying with temperature). Check for continuity in the wiring from sensor to ECM, and verify ground integrity at the sensor mounting point.
Step 3: Connector and Voltage Verification Inspect connector pins for corrosion, bent terminals, or moisture. Clean with electrical contact cleaner if needed. With ignition on and sensor disconnected, measure supply voltage at the harness connector (should be approximately 5V reference voltage). If voltage is absent or incorrect, trace wiring back to the ECM.
Step 4: Component Replacement If sensor resistance is out of specification or wiring shows damage, replace the faulty component. For used machines, always replace connector seals and apply dielectric grease to prevent future corrosion. After repairs, clear codes using Komatsu diagnostic software and verify proper operation under load.
